    Energy efficiency

    Double glazing has been scientifically proven to make a big difference in the flow of heat into and out of homes. It can help reduce the flow of heat during winter and block unwanted solar gain in summer, reducing the power consumption. This results in lower energy bills and a less carbon footprint. A well-insulated home can be kept warmer for longer and require less heating, thereby saving money in the long run.

    The air between the two glass panes of double-glazed windows is a great insulator, slowing the process of transferring heat from and into a house. This is because air molecules aren't able to transfer heat as effectively as glass. Double-glazed windows are, therefore, more energy efficient than those with single glazing.

    Condensation control

    Condensation can cause surfaces like walls and floors to smell musty, spread mildew spores and adversely affect woodwork. Double glazing reduces condensation by keeping the inner surface of the glass warm. However if windows aren't installed properly, moisture may be able to seep through the gap between the panes, and damage the window seal. If the window is fitted to an existing brick wall, moisture could develop between the glass panes as well as the frame. In these cases, a replacement of the entire window is needed.

    A faulty seal is usually the reason for condensation between the panes in windows with double glazing. This can occur due to the degeneration of the sealant which allows air to enter the window's space and reacts with air's moisture to produce condensation. The strips of rubber are commonly used as a sealant in cheaper double-glazed window replacement near me instead of silicone, which could speed up condensation.

    Security

    Double glazing is a fantastic method to increase the security of your home. Double glazing can be an excellent method to increase home security. The additional layer of tempered glass deters burglars and many modern windows feature multi-point locking mechanisms that make it hard for them to force the window to open. However, it's important to remember that double-glazing isn't burglar-proof, and home owners should combine it with other security measures for optimal safety.
